IP查询
查询
你查询的IP:[218.221.176.186] 地理位置:日本
最新查询
118.80.177.172
117.128.216.153
124.249.232.140
221.176.137.206
118.192.155.196
117.112.1.19
124.128.137.210
121.248.214.132
121.255.155.140
218.221.176.186
202.38.176.97
119.18.192.9
210.15.135.218
119.18.192.131
116.252.104.186
58.87.64.148
202.14.238.235
202.43.144.206
119.144.90.189
116.213.64.11
202.38.176.247
119.40.128.165
202.38.152.188
203.187.160.232
59.80.4.44
124.126.161.79
210.14.64.155
116.255.128.181
123.206.51.160
117.76.28.137
114.54.75.234